Abstract |
|
A satellite image is used for analyzing what is happening around the world, but these images are often corrupted by different noises during acquisition and transmission. The main objective of noise reduction technique is to reduce the noise without degrading important features in the images. The conventional denoising methods can reduce the Gaussian noise but fails to maintain the quality of the images and blurs the edges in an image. To overcome these drawbacks an optimized adaptive thresholding function based framework for edge preserved satellite image denoising using Hybrid cuckoo search and grey-wolf algorithm which is capable of effectively removing Gaussian noise from the images without over smoothening the edge details. |
